Counselling and Support for Men Dealing with Infertility
The journey through male infertility is often intensely personal, and can shake the foundation of how you see yourself. For many men, the struggle to conceive brings on feelings of failure, shame, or a fundamental questioning of their masculinity. If you or your partner are navigating the challenges of infertility, you don't have to carry the emotional burden alone.
I offer confidential, non-judgmental counselling for the specific emotional issues tied to male fertility challenges. This often includes:
The pressure of repeated IVF cycles and treatments.
Intense feelings of low self-worth or identity crisis.
Dealing with the constant comparison and questions about fatherhood.
Managing the stress and grief associated with a diagnosis or failed attempts
My approach to male infertility counselling is focused on creating a safe space where you can be honest about the emotional impact of this process. In our sessions, whether in my Basingstoke room, online, or during a Walk & Talk, we will focus on:
Reclaiming Identity: Separating your worth as a man from your ability to reproduce.
Grief and Acceptance: Processing the profound sense of loss that comes with unmet expectations.
